Especially this paragraph:

To determine the condition of the diaphragm, remove hose from servo unit
and apply 14 inches of
vacuum to the tube opening and hold in for one minute. The vacuum shall
not leak down more than
5 inches of vacuum in one minute. If leakage is detected, replace servo.

Sorry up front If I dont have correct names. But I have a vacuum line that runs up under the dash visible from the driver side hood, Following that line back, it has a T just before the vacuum pot with the ball chain on it going to the throttle. So one line into that Vacuum pot, and the other end of that T runs to a second T close to the transducer. One line runs to the larger rear most port on the transducer, and the other end of that second T, runs back up to the Top port on the transducer. The smaller (last) port has a line which runs to the back of the carb.

Hope this helps.
